Keyless entry
A keyless entry system lets you to open the trunk and doors of Subaru without having to use an ordinary mechanical key. The car's computers detect the presence of the key fob using a radio signal and sends an indication to unlock the doors or opening the trunk. This system can also be used to start or stop the engine. Some advanced systems even offer remote starting, smartphone connectivity and alarms.

Key code
Subaru key fobs are equipped with the security chip used to secure and unlock your car. When a key is inserted into the ignition, a signal is sent to a receiver located on the dashboard. The key's unique signal must be acknowledged by the dashboard receiver in order to start the engine. If your key fob doesn't work, it may be time to change the battery.
Find the eight-digit code on your vehicle prior program the Subaru key. The code can be found on the original ringtag or on Subarunet. Once you have the code, you need to open and close the door on the driver's side. Then press the lock button a number of times that corresponds to each number.
Then next, insert the new key into the ignition and turn it to the "on" position, but don't start the engine. The security light should stop flashing when the key fob is beginning to work. If the security light continues to flash then you might need to replace the battery. You can also contact an expert locksmith for assistance.
